Anyone that you interact with regularly on another team is a good candidate for a peer one on one and in particular here's ones I've seen work well: Any pairing of a Product Manager, Designer, and Engineer, especially team leads. A Marketer and Designer that work together on projects.

Managers should look at check-ins as their primary forum for management. This is the time to touch base about projects, get aligned on priorities and how to approach key issues, give feedback, and serve as a resource – so that you’re not popping in to do all this randomly throughout the week … or worse, not doing it at all. 2.

WebApr 9, 2024 · Here are the top 10 questions great managers ask to have productive and engaging one-on-one meetings with direct reports: How’s life outside of work? What are your top priorities this week? What’s one recent win and one recent situation you wish you handled differently? Would you like more or less direction from me?
